  • 4. 

    Pre-tribulationists believe that Christ will return how many times

    • A.

      1

    • B.

      2

    • C.

      3

    • D.

      4

    Correct Answer
    B. 2
    Explanation
    Pre-tribulationists believe that Christ will return two times. The first return, known as the Rapture, is believed to be a secret event where believers are taken up to meet Christ in the air before the period of tribulation on Earth begins. The second return is when Christ comes back to Earth with His believers to establish His millennial kingdom and defeat evil. This belief is based on interpretations of biblical passages such as 1 Thessalonians 4:16-17 and Revelation 19:11-16.

  • 19. 

    According to 2 Thessalonians 2:1-4, which comes first; the return of "Christ" or the "man of lawlessness?"

    • A.

      Christ

    • B.

      Man of lawlessness

    Correct Answer
    B. Man of lawlessness
    Explanation
    According to 2 Thessalonians 2:1-4, the man of lawlessness comes before the return of Christ. This passage discusses the events that will occur before the second coming of Christ. It states that the man of lawlessness, who is often understood to be the Antichrist, will be revealed and exalt himself above God. After this, the passage mentions that Christ will come and destroy the man of lawlessness with the breath of his mouth. Therefore, based on this scripture, the man of lawlessness precedes the return of Christ.
